How they compare

Western Africa currently reports 71,508 kt against 137.62 kt in Republic of Moldova, a difference of 71,370 kt.

That makes Western Africa's figure about 519.6 times Republic of Moldova's.

Across all 34 years both countries report, Western Africa has been ahead every year.

Republic of Moldova ranks 16th and Western Africa ranks 14th of 20 countries.

Western Africa has averaged higher in every one of the 6 decades both report.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
